What Causes Ducted Heat Pump to Leak?
Why Do Coils Contribute to Water Leakage?
Heat pump coils play a critical role in moisture management. When these components become compromised, leakage becomes inevitable:
- Dirty Coil Complications
- Accumulated dust and debris interfere with proper drainage
- Reduces heat transfer efficiency
-
Creates blockages in condensate pathways
-
Frozen Coil Consequences
- Low refrigerant levels trigger freezing
- Melting ice produces excessive water accumulation
- Potential system performance degradation
How Does Condensate Drain System Impact Leakage?
The condensate drain system is your heat pump’s primary water management mechanism. Potential failure points include:
Drain System Component | Potential Issue | Consequence |
---|---|---|
Drain Line | Blockage | Water backup |
Drain Pan | Crack or damage | Direct water leakage |
Drain Slope | Improper installation | Inadequate water flow |

What Are Repair Considerations?
Cost Breakdown
- Labor Expenses: $75 – $200 per hour
- Part Replacement: $100 – $500
- Total Repair Range: $300 – $1,500
Repair Process Steps
- System shutdown
- Leak source identification
- Component repair/replacement
- Refrigerant recharging
- Comprehensive system testing
